Dua for the Blessings of the Prophet's Hijrah in Madinah

Hajj & Umrah
Sahih HadithSahih Muslim 1375

اللَّهُمَّ بَارِكْ لَنَا فِي مَدِينَتِنَا، وَبَارِكْ لَنَا فِي صَاعِنَا وَمُدِّنَا، وَبَارِكْ لَنَا فِي مَكَّتِنَا، اللَّهُمَّ إِنَّ إِبْرَاهِيمَ عَبْدُكَ وَخَلِيلُكَ وَنَبِيُّكَ، وَقَدْ دَعَاكَ لِمَكَّةَ، وَأَنَا عَبْدُكَ وَرَسُولُكَ، وَأَدْعُوكَ لِلْمَدِينَةِ، كَمَا دَعَاكَ إِبْرَاهِيمُ لِمَكَّةَ، اللَّهُمَّ بَارِكْ لَنَا فِي مَدِينَتِنَا، وَبَارِكْ لَنَا فِي صَاعِنَا وَمُدِّنَا، وَصِحَّتَنَا، وَبَارِكْ لَنَا فِي ثَمَرَةٍ، وَاجْعَلْ مَعَ ذَلِكَ بَيْتَيْنِ.

O Allah, bless us in our Madinah, and bless us in our measure (Sa' and Mudd), and bless us in our Makkah. O Allah, indeed Ibrahim is Your servant, Your close friend, and Your Prophet. He supplicated to You for Makkah, and I am Your servant and Your Messenger. I supplicate to You for Madinah, just as Ibrahim supplicated to You for Makkah. O Allah, bless us in our Madinah, and bless us in our measure (Sa' and Mudd), and our health, and bless us in our fruit, and make with that two houses (meaning the Ka'bah and the Prophet's mosque).

Allahumma barik lana fi Madinah, wa barik lana fi sa'ina wa muddina, wa barik lana fi makkatinā. Allahumma inna Ibrahim 'abdoka wa khaleeluka wa nabiyyuka, wa qad da'aka li Makkah, wa ana 'abdoka wa Rasooluka, wa ad'ooka lil Madinah, kama da'aka Ibrahim li Makkah. Allahumma barik lana fi Madinah, wa barik lana fi sa'ina wa muddina, wa sihhatina, wa barik lana fi thamarah, waj'al ma'a dhalika baytayni.

When to Read

This dua is particularly relevant when visiting Madinah, especially during Hajj or Umrah. It can be recited at any time, but its significance is amplified when you are physically present in the blessed city, reflecting on the Prophet's ﷺ journey and the city's establishment. Reciting it after Fajr or Isha prayer, or when visiting Rawdah, can enhance the spiritual connection.

How to Read

Recite with sincerity and heartfelt intention, focusing on the blessings of Madinah and the Prophet's ﷺ life there. It is recommended to face the Qiblah, if possible, and to raise your hands in supplication, as was the practice of the Prophet ﷺ when making dua. Imagine the sacrifices made during the Hijrah and the immense blessings that flowed from it.

Virtues & Benefits

This dua encapsulates the Prophet's ﷺ profound connection to Madinah and his supplication for its prosperity and the well-being of its people. By reciting it, we connect with that supplication, seeking Allah's barakah (blessings) for ourselves and for the city that became the center of Islam. It reminds us of the spiritual significance of Madinah, the City of the Prophet ﷺ, and the historical importance of the Hijrah.
